## Fleet Fuel Report

For the weekly sync: the Harkwell fleet fuel-usage report aggregates pump transactions and odometer readings into per-vehicle efficiency numbers each Sunday night. The job runs on the Corsair batch cluster and usually finishes in under twenty minutes. Anomalies — like a vehicle logging fuel with no mileage — land in a review queue that ops clears Monday morning. New team members running the aggregation locally should point the job at the reporting replica using the connection string below.

database URL for fawig-tagag: cockroachdb://briwyn_svc:xY@db-f6f3.xolmartech.local:5432/kelius

Finance Review Summary — Retail Pilot

Prepared for the board: the pilot with the Ashvale Stores chain has completed its second quarter. Revenue to date stands at 112% of plan, while logistics costs exceed estimates by roughly 8%, attributable to split shipments to regional depots. Margin remains within the approved corridor. A decision on full rollout is scheduled for the next board cycle, pending renegotiated freight terms. For completeness, the confidential note on forward business plans follows immediately below.

confidential, kagap-kajeg: Istethax Holdings is in early talks to buy Ulaielix Works for about $23.7 million. The Lamys launch date is July 6, and nothing goes to the press before then.

HANDOVER NOTE — Q3 Cash-Flow Forecast

Mira — passing the forecast file over as agreed. Headline: collections from the Tresco pipeline land mostly in September, so August looks thinner than it really is. Sales leads should keep pushing early invoicing on the Calderwell renewals; that's the swing factor. Assumptions tab is current as of last Friday. Shout if anything looks off. The confidential note on plans is just below.

— Gareth

board note of kageg-bahof: The renewal with Holwynax Holdings closes at $2 million a year, 5 percent below the last contract. Project Ulaath slips by two quarters because of the supplier delay.